The Cursor + Voice Workflow

Step 1: Dictate Your Intent

Speak naturally about what you want to build:

"Create a function that takes a user ID, fetches their profile from the database, and returns it as JSON. Handle the case where the user doesn't exist."

Step 2: Let Cursor Generate

Cursor's AI turns your description into working code. Tab to accept, or refine with voice:

"Add error logging and input validation"

Step 3: Document by Voice

While Cursor codes, you dictate documentation:

  • Function docstrings
  • Inline comments
  • README updates
